Did you read this line?
"To re-enable in Chromium, just append --enable-aero-peek-tabs to your shortcut's target field."
Instead of Bill, it will be your username of course.
- Locate your Chrome or Chromium shortcut. There should be one on your desktop and one in your start menu - either one will work.
- Right Click the shortcut and choose properties.
- Find the target box (it will be highlighted when the properties screen appears).
- Left click at the end of the line (after chrome.exe).
- Press space.
- Add your command line switch. The result looks like this:
C:\Users\Bill\AppData\Local\Google\Chrome\Application\chrome.exe --enable-aero-peek-tabs
